During the TakeOver: In Your House pay-per-view, a commercial aired for the next NXT event, the Great American Bash. The Bash won't be a stand-alone TakeOver event but rather an episode of NXT on Tuesday, July 6.

At last year's Great American Bash, Io Shirai defeated Sasha Banks while Keith Lee won a Winner Takes All match against Adam Cole. By winning, Lee became both the NXT and NXT North American Champion. He vacated the NA title soon after defeating Cole.

Lee then dropped the NXT title to Karrion Kross at TakeOver: XXX in August. During their match, however, Kross was injured and was forced to vacate the title. It took some time but Kross returned to NXT earlier this year and reclaimed the title he never lost.

TakeOver: In Your House featured an action-packed card, but there weren't any title changes. Gonzalez, Kross and MSK won their titles at Stand & Deliver in April. Bronson Reed won the NA title in May while Kushida defeated Santos Escobar for the NXT Cruiserweight title in April.

With so many titles changing hands recently, it didn't seem likely that fans would see any new champions walk out of TakeOver: In Your House. Every title that was on the line was defended successfully.

Since every championship was safe after TakeOver: In Your House, the same may not be the case at the Great American Bash. Another month will have passed, giving those winning titles at Stand & Deliver a three-month reign. While those reigns are still relatively short, NXT management could pull the trigger on title swaps.

Kross defeated four of the best stars in NXT history and may relinquish the title before being promoted to RAW or SmackDown. The 2021 WWE Draft will take place after SummerSlam, so Kross could feasibly move up after SummerSlam.

Gonzalez and Kross may hold their titles for a long time, but if the main roster comes calling, things can change. MSK might see their reign end with a tag division full of hungry teams.
